Key differences

Both DRSK and AGZ are fixed income ETFs. DRSK charges 0.78% a year and AGZ 0.20%. The main difference: DRSK follows a option income strategy; AGZ uses index tracking.

  • DRSK follows a option income strategy; AGZ uses index tracking.
  • AGZ costs 0.58% less per year.
  • Over the last three years, DRSK has delivered higher annualized returns.
  • AGZ has a longer track record, which may reduce uncertainty around long-term behavior.
